pls check processing fee, charges which can be in range of 0.5 to 0.75 percentage.after 1st year discount , bank can increase loan rate. If loan tenure is 5+ years, go for it.
MOD Charge range is 0.1% to 0.5%. Axis Bank is charging me 0.2%.
Definitely it is, even .1% matters a lot
New banks will sell new insurance to you and other mortgage expenses extra.
Try to bargain with icici, they will definitely give you a good deal
Update: I decided to go ahead with the transfer. Got a sanctioned letter of 8.4% ROI. Axis bank agreed with zero processing fee with no insurance. Disbursement is in progress...
